As for the Gameboy Micro, well what a buy! Not bad considering I was originally seeing if I could find an original GBA but saw the price tag on the Micro and JUST HAD TO ASK! The Micro is damn small. Bit bigger than a box of matches. Screen is really cool. So bright and easy to view. Buttons handle well but L and R buttons are a little way off to reach in a hurry. This thing is best suited to RPG's I think. Text can be read with little hassles. Face plate is a cool idea. My first eBay search shall be to get the Game & Watch plate as I collect Game & Watches (have 12 G&W's with 3 of them in original boxes!). Down side to the Micro is it won't run Gameboy Colour or plain old sucky GB games. No real heart ache but Zelda: Ages and Seasons are games I'm meaning to finish off! But overall this new mean little monster is one heck of a console. I'm not even sure if you could class it as a console as it's so small!
